Guna (Madhya Pradesh): Madhya Pradesh’s Guna police arrested 9 people in connection with the stone-pelting case that occurred in the district on the occasion of Hanuman Jayanti (April 12, Saturday night), as reported by PTI on Sunday.

According to information, BJP councillor Omprakash Kushwah, also known as Gabbar, filed a police complaint on Saturday. Based on his complaint, around 25 people were charged with attempted murder, assault, rioting, and vandalism. 

The councillor also claimed that gunshots were fired during the incident.

District Collector Kishore Kanyal and SP Sanjeev Kumar visited the location to assess the situation and spoke to members of both communities.

What was the matter?

As per reports,the procession began at 4 pm from the Shivaji Nagar Mata Mandir on April 12. A DJ led the procession while a group of young people danced behind it. 

Around 7:30 PM, the procession reached the Colonelganj area and stopped near a mosque. It was here that stones were reportedly thrown at the procession, sparking violence from both sides.

Minister Jyotiraditya Scindia spoke to SP 

Police quickly arrived at the scene and dispersed the crowd to control the situation. Later that night, Union Minister Jyotiraditya Scindia spoke with Guna SP Sanjeev Kumar to get updates regarding the incident.

After the stone-pelting, participants of the procession gathered at Hanuman Chowk and blocked the road in protest. Officials convinced them to head to the Kotwali police station instead, after which the roadblock ended.
